Lincoln Financial Foundation Collection

The Lincoln Financial Foundation Collection is not a person but a renowned archive of Abraham Lincoln-related materials, initiated in 1905 by the Lincoln National Life Insurance Company in Fort Wayne, Indiana, to associate with Lincoln's values. It grew significantly from the 1920s through the Lincoln Historical Research Foundation and by 2008 became one of the largest private collections of its kind before being donated to the State of Indiana. The collection is now housed at the Allen County Public Library in Fort Wayne for two-dimensional items and the Indiana State Museum in Indianapolis for three-dimensional artifacts.[1][2][4][6]
